The musical project Enigma, created by German producer Michael Cretu in 1990, revolutionized the landscape of electronic, ambient, and new-age music. By blending hypnotic electronic beats, Gregorian chants, ethnic instrumentation, and atmospheric soundscapes, Enigma created a sonic blueprint that has captivated listeners for over three decades. Throughout the 1990s and 2000s, Enigma released dozens of CD Maxi-Singles and vinyl records featuring extended suites and exclusive club interpretations. Notable remixes include the 380 Midnight Mix of "Sadeness," the Peter Ries remixes of "Turn to Innocence," and Chicane’s lush progressive house take on "Boum-Boum."
